Boloco to close Davis Square location

Boloco, a local taqueria chain known for its overstuffed burritos, will close its Davis Square location tonight.

The Boston-based company struggled to attract pedestrians to the Somerville store, which is a 10-minute walk from the nearest T stop. In addition, Boloco had a difficult time competing with the half dozen other burrito eateries scattered around Davis Square and Porter Square.

"It's the lowest volume restaurant we opened in a dozen years," John S. Pepper, the chief executive officer and co-founder said in a phone interview today. "There's only so much you can do before you throw in the towel."

The restaurant, located on 187 Elm Street, serves about 200 customers a day, while the other 11 Boston locations serve between 500 to 1,000 customers a day. In the eighteen months that the Davis Square store has been opened, it generated less than $500,000 in sales.

"We thought if you build it they would come," he said. "But the customers never came."

Pepper said the bad location is mostly to blame. The Somerville store, which is situated midway between the Davis Square and Porter Square MBTA stops, was hard to reach for riders who took the train. Boloco faded in the background as better-located burrito restaurants like Anna's Taqueria, Chipotle, Qdoba, and Boca Grande drew large crowds.

The Davis Square location did became a favorite for parents in the neighborhood, Pepper said. It was the only Boloco with a play area. Somerville groups for mothers and other organizations came in weekly with their children. He notified these patrons early this morning on a blog and via email -- when the news was final.

"We've met some wonderful people at Davis," Pepper wrote on an online message board today at 4:42 a.m. under the title "O, woe! No mo Boloco after tonight."

This is the first time the chain has closed one of its locations, and Pepper stressed this is the only store that is closing. Boloco, which was called The Wrap when it opened in 1997, continues with its expansion plans. It opened a new restaurant in Burlington, Vermont on Friday, and plans to build another nine locations in the next year, including five in the Boston area.

The twelve employees that work at the Davis Square store will be moved to another location in Boston. Boloco is having a farewell party tonight from 6 to 8 p.m. Kids will eat for free and burritos and smoothies will only be $3 for adults.
